BIOGRAPHY

Ricardo René García is a pivotal figure in the world of Latin American cinema, particularly known for his influential directing in the 1970s. His film "La ñata contra el vidrio" (1972) stands out as a hallmark of both his career and the era, showcasing a unique blend of social commentary and engaging storytelling that resonates deeply with collectors. This film, often sought after for its artistic merit and cultural significance, exemplifies the raw, unfiltered narrative style that García championed.
